Rob: Are you sure you were running it with a clean power supply? Any 60 Hz ripple on the supply could show up as AM/PM modulation. You might want to try another 5V power supply before you give up on the oscillator. --- Graham

What was disappointing was all the > spurious at 60 Hz intervals relatively close-in to the 10 MHz carrier. I > suppose if all one wants is a reasonably accurate 10 MHz, then they work > OK. My good one and Adam's unit were 1x10^7 low in frequency once warmed > up, and there are pins for frequency adjustment and sync to another > standard.
